The Indigenous Identity of the South Saami: Historical and Political Perspectives on a Minority within a Minority
This open access book is a novel contribution in two ways: It is a multi-disciplinary examination of the indigenous South Saami people in Fennoscandia, a social and cultural group that often is overlooked as it is a minority within the Saami minority.
